Boundary Definitions

1 of 3) Boundary, Bound, Bounds : حد : (noun) the line or plane indicating the limit or extent of something.

2 of 3) Boundary, Bound, Edge : حد, سرحد, باڑ : (noun) a line determining the limits of an area.

3 of 3) Boundary, Bound, Limit : حد, انتہا : (noun) the greatest possible degree of something.
